Originally Posted by SkyTeam777
Do NetBank or Bank Direct offer miles for opening CDs? Anyone know about mileage offers for Virtual Bank?
BankDirect does.
1,000 miles for every $1,000.00 spent on a two-year Mileage CD purchase.
500 miles for every $1,000.00 spent on a one-year Mileage CD purchase.
250 miles for every $1,000.00 spent on a 6-month Mileage CD purchase.

Originally Posted by coachflyer
Bank Direct does not allow for direct access for my checking account. Every transaction is either with hard copies and is very slow and requires telephone calls to verify it. Interest rates are very low.
No direct access? I use standard checks like any other bank. I also use their electronic bill paying service, and have had no problems. I also direct deposit into the account, and can perform ACH transfers both in and out at no charge. I use my ING account as the "clearinghouse" to perform the ACH transfers - just "link" your accounts.....

Yes, the interest rate is low, but if you add up the account opening bonuses, bill pay bonus, and direct deposit bonus, the cost per mile is not that bad, especially if you only keep the $2,500 minimum to avoid the monthly fee. Also, interest is taxable, miles are not (at least not yet).
